Strengthening collaboration on plurilingualism and intercultural communication across Arqus

The transition from Arqus II to the Arqus Bridge period is opening new opportunities to build on the Alliance’s achievements and further strengthen collaboration among its member universities.

As part of this ongoing process, Dr Tomasz Wysłobocki, from Wrocław University, recently visited the Institute of Foreign Languages at Vilnius University. The visit provided an opportunity to reflect on the achievements of Arqus II and to discuss how previous collaboration on plurilingualism and intercultural communication can be further developed in the next stage of the Alliance.

The meeting also offered a valuable opportunity for an in-person exchange on shared priorities and future activities. Particular attention was given to promoting intercultural communication and plurilingualism as key elements of an inclusive and diverse European university community.

Dr Wysłobocki and Prof. Dr Roma Kriaučiūnienė, Director of the Institute of Foreign Languages at Vilnius University, discussed the next steps for their joint work and identified new opportunities for continued collaboration within Arqus. The discussions resulted in a concrete plan for future activities aimed at strengthening intercultural dialogue, promoting plurilingual practices and contributing to the Alliance’s shared commitment to European values.

As Arqus Bridge moves forward, the Alliance continues to create opportunities for its member universities to exchange expertise, develop joint initiatives and strengthen cooperation across borders, contributing to a more inclusive, multilingual and intercultural European higher education landscape.
